Blue Jays fan who arrived speaking no English gets his dream day at Rogers Centre
Rodrigo Farias, who immigrated from Chile at age eight, won the Rogers Game Day Owner contest and will get behind-the-scenes access to the stadium.

Rodrigo Farias arrived in Canada from Chile at age eight knowing almost no English — only the numbers one through fifty, "hello," "how are you," and "bye." His first Blue Jays game became one of his earliest memories of feeling welcome in his new home.
"The experience was surreal," Farias recalled. "It was a sport I'd never seen before in a stadium I'd never been to, with a massive amount of people in the crowd. Everybody cheered and chanted. It was fantastic." He remembers getting a T-shirt, foam finger, and hat.
But one moment stayed with him: sitting a few rows behind the dugout, his stepfather encouraged him to call out to Carlos Delgado in Spanish. "He looked up, said something to me and waved," Farias said. "To me, I was just like, 'Wow.' Not only am I this close to the players, but they acknowledged me. They made me feel welcome in my first game."
That moment sparked a lifelong passion for the team. "You see somebody wearing a Blue Jays hat across the street, you make eye contact, nod or say, 'Go Jays,'" Farias said. "There's that connection, that passion of the team, that brotherhood."
Now, 25 years later, Farias has won the Rogers Game Day Owner contest, giving him behind-the-scenes access to Rogers Centre — including the clubhouse, dugout, and field — plus the chance to meet players and share ideas with club executives.
When he received the call telling him he'd been selected, he was driving to work. "I wanted to pull over and scream," he said with a laugh. The opportunity comes during what has already been a milestone year: Farias recently became a Canadian citizen and is preparing to get married in just two weeks.
